Who can Man United draw in Europa League quarter finals?

United’s chances of European success will rest heavily on who they meet in the rounds before the final.

Sevilla are the most successful team in Europa League/UEFA Cup history, and they have dumped United out of two European competitions since 2018, when the Red Devils were managed by Jose Mourinho and then Ole Gunnar Solskjaer.

Real Sociedad would also be a threat after beating United earlier this season to finish top of Group E, forcing Ten Hag’s side into a Round of 16 playoff against Barcelona. They are facing Mourinho’s Roma in the last 16 — another side who would pose a challenge to United.

Italian giants Juventus, inspired of late by former United midfielder Angel Di Maria, could also lie in wait.

Can Man United draw English clubs in quarter finals?

Unlike the Round of 16 where teams from the same nation were kept apart, the quarterfinals are set via a completely open draw in which any club can face another

This means United could indeed face Premier League rivals Arsenal if the Gunners overcome Sporting CP in their last-16 tie.

If they are drawn as opponents in the quarterfinals, it will be a first European meeting between the pair since the 2008/09 Champions League, where a Cristiano Ronaldo-inspired United stormed past Arsenal at the semifinal stage.

Man United in Europa League quarterfinals 

United have spent the majority of the Premier League era competing in the Champions League, with their first Europa League appearance coming in 2011/12, in Sir Alex Ferguson’s penultimate campaign.

Since exiting the competition to Liverpool at the last-16 stage in 2016, the Red Devils have won all three of their Europa League quarterfinal ties.

Season Opponent Result on aggregate
2020/21 Granada Won 4-0
2019/20 FC Copenhagen Won 1-0 (single-leg tie)
2016/17 Anderlecht Won 3-2
